Transaction 2c12ec45eb25428fd69f9d5b17c332c66a9fb4e5553bd19d50a0044a7dc82d9c

block
a250884b841674b54a017509a673f586139f3534b6ebb7d62bd14f7122323594

1 Input

23 Outputs